SN74ALVCH162820DLR Description

SN74ALVCH162820DLR Description

The SN74ALVCH162820DLR is a 10-bit D-type flip-flop logic IC chip manufactured by Texas Instruments. This device is designed to provide high-speed performance with a clock frequency of up to 150 MHz, making it suitable for demanding digital applications. It features a positive edge trigger type, ensuring reliable data capture on the rising edge of the clock signal. The chip operates within a supply voltage range of 1.65V to 3.6V, providing flexibility in power supply requirements.

The SN74ALVCH162820DLR is housed in a surface-mount package, specifically a 56-lead SSOP, which is ideal for compact and high-density PCB designs. It has an input capacitance of 3.5 pF, contributing to its high-speed operation. The device also boasts a maximum propagation delay of 5.4ns at 3.3V and 50pF, ensuring fast signal transmission and minimal latency.

SN74ALVCH162820DLR Features

  • High-Speed Performance: With a clock frequency of up to 150 MHz, the SN74ALVCH162820DLR is capable of handling high-speed digital signals, making it suitable for applications requiring rapid data processing.
  • Low Power Consumption: The device has a quiescent current (Iq) of 40 µA, ensuring efficient power usage and minimal energy consumption, which is crucial for battery-operated and low-power systems.
  • Wide Supply Voltage Range: Operating within a supply voltage range of 1.65V to 3.6V, the SN74ALVCH162820DLR offers flexibility in power supply requirements, making it compatible with various systems.
  • High Output Current Capability: The chip provides a high output current of 12mA for both high and low states, ensuring robust signal drive capabilities.
  • Compliance and Safety: The SN74ALVCH162820DLR is REACH unaffected and ROHS3 compliant, ensuring it meets environmental and safety standards. It also has a moisture sensitivity level (MSL) of 1, making it suitable for unlimited storage and handling conditions.
  • Single Element Design: The device contains a single element with 10 bits per element, simplifying design and integration into various digital systems.
